NEW DELHI: Swedish audio streaming service Spotify has stated singer Arijit Singh has been probably the most streamed artiste in India in 2021, identical to final yr. Different prime artistes embody Pritam, AR Rahman, Korean band BTS, Tanishk Baghi, Shreya Ghoshal, Jubin Nautiyal, Neha Kakkar, Anirudh Ravichander and Vishal-Shekhar.
Essentially the most streamed music of 2021 is Raataan Lambiyan by Asees Kaur, Jubin Nautiyal, Tanishk Bagchi from struggle drama Shershaah that streamed on Amazon Prime Video. Shershaah can also be among the many most streamed albums in India throughout the yr together with Okabir Singh, Moosetape, Love Your self, Reply, Love Aaj Kal, Justice, BE, MAP OF THE SOUL: 7, Grasp and Future Nostalgia.
High Hits Hindi is the most-streamed playlist in India this yr with 636,000 followers, practically double from the earlier yr, when the playlist was at primary. New Music Punjabi, Punjabi 101, As we speak’s High Hits and This Is BTS comprise the remaining prime 4 most streamed playlists, the service stated.
The most well-liked podcasts on Spotify in India this yr are The Mythpat Podcast, The Ranveer Present, The Tales of Mahabharata, Naallanaa Murukku- The RJ Balaji Podcast, Srimad Bhagvad-Gita Adhyay 1, The Joe Rogan Expertise, Converse Higher English With Harry and Unconventional Ghalib.
In accordance with an earlier Mint report, with easing of covid restrictions in most elements of the nation and work commutes getting again on observe, audio streaming providers that had seen a 5-15% drop throughout the peak of the second wave, at the moment are seeing a bounce again.
States like Delhi, Maharashtra and Gujarat stay prime contributors to listenership although folks nonetheless want soulful, even non secular tracks in comparison with social gathering music, reflecting their frame of mind and life-style. Bollywood might stay an everlasting favorite however regional languages like Telugu and Bhojpuri have gained at its expense given the absence of too many new movies previously year-and-a-half.
